The number of oscillations or vibrations made by a vibrating body in one second is known as the frequency of the wave. The SI unit of frequency is hertz(Hz)which is named after the name of scientist Heinrich Hertz. Time taken to complete one vibration by the vibrating body is known as the time period. Time period and frequency are related as

Timeperiod=1frequency

Solution

The correct option is A

0.05 s.


Step 1: Given data

Frequency of sound, f=20Hz

Time period, T=?

Step 2: Formula used

The time period in terms of the frequency of the wave is,

T=1f

Step 3: Calculation of the time period

Substituting the given value of frequency in the above equation,

T=120HzT=0.05s

Hence, option (A) is correct.
